Uses of Class
org.camunda.bpm.engine.impl.pvm.process.ProcessDefinitionImpl
Package
Description
API implementation classes, which shouldn't directly be used by end-users.
-
Uses of ProcessDefinitionImpl in org.camunda.bpm.engine.impl
Modifier and TypeFieldDescriptionprotected ProcessDefinitionImpl
ActivityExecutionTreeMapping.processDefinition
Modifier and TypeMethodDescriptionprotected Long
DefaultPriorityProvider.getProcessDefinedPriority
(ProcessDefinitionImpl processDefinition, String propertyKey, ExecutionEntity execution, String errorMsgHead) Returns the priority which is defined in the given process definition. -
Uses of ProcessDefinitionImpl in org.camunda.bpm.engine.impl.bpmn.parser
Modifier and TypeMethodDescriptionvoid
UnresolvedReference.resolve
(ProcessDefinitionImpl processDefinition) -
Uses of ProcessDefinitionImpl in org.camunda.bpm.engine.impl.cmd
Modifier and TypeMethodDescriptionActivityCancellationCmd.collectParentScopeIdsForActivity
(ProcessDefinitionImpl processDefinition, String activityId) protected ActivityImpl
StartProcessInstanceAtActivitiesCmd.determineFirstActivity
(ProcessDefinitionImpl processDefinition, ProcessInstanceModificationBuilderImpl modificationBuilder) get the activity that is started by the first instruction, if exists; return null if the first instruction is a start-transition instructionprotected TransitionImpl
ActivityAfterInstantiationCmd.findTransition
(ProcessDefinitionImpl processDefinition) protected List<MigrationInstruction>
CreateMigrationPlanCmd.generateInstructions
(CommandContext commandContext, ProcessDefinitionImpl sourceProcessDefinition, ProcessDefinitionImpl targetProcessDefinition, boolean updateEventTriggers) protected ScopeImpl
AbstractProcessInstanceModificationCommand.getScopeForActivityInstance
(ProcessDefinitionImpl processDefinition, ActivityInstance activityInstance) protected abstract CoreModelElement
AbstractInstantiationCmd.getTargetElement
(ProcessDefinitionImpl processDefinition) protected CoreModelElement
ActivityAfterInstantiationCmd.getTargetElement
(ProcessDefinitionImpl processDefinition) protected CoreModelElement
ActivityBeforeInstantiationCmd.getTargetElement
(ProcessDefinitionImpl processDefinition) protected CoreModelElement
TransitionInstantiationCmd.getTargetElement
(ProcessDefinitionImpl processDefinition) protected abstract ScopeImpl
AbstractInstantiationCmd.getTargetFlowScope
(ProcessDefinitionImpl processDefinition) protected ScopeImpl
ActivityAfterInstantiationCmd.getTargetFlowScope
(ProcessDefinitionImpl processDefinition) protected ScopeImpl
ActivityBeforeInstantiationCmd.getTargetFlowScope
(ProcessDefinitionImpl processDefinition) protected ScopeImpl
TransitionInstantiationCmd.getTargetFlowScope
(ProcessDefinitionImpl processDefinition) protected void
CreateMigrationPlanCmd.validateMigrationInstructions
(CommandContext commandContext, MigrationPlanValidationReportImpl planReport, MigrationPlanImpl migrationPlan, ProcessDefinitionImpl sourceProcessDefinition, ProcessDefinitionImpl targetProcessDefinition) protected ValidatingMigrationInstructions
CreateMigrationPlanCmd.wrapMigrationInstructions
(MigrationPlan migrationPlan, ProcessDefinitionImpl sourceProcessDefinition, ProcessDefinitionImpl targetProcessDefinition, MigrationPlanValidationReportImpl planReport) -
Uses of ProcessDefinitionImpl in org.camunda.bpm.engine.impl.jobexecutor
-
Uses of ProcessDefinitionImpl in org.camunda.bpm.engine.impl.migration
Modifier and TypeMethodDescriptionDefaultMigrationInstructionGenerator.generate
(ProcessDefinitionImpl sourceProcessDefinition, ProcessDefinitionImpl targetProcessDefinition, boolean updateEventTriggers) void
DefaultMigrationInstructionGenerator.generate
(ScopeImpl sourceScope, ScopeImpl targetScope, ProcessDefinitionImpl sourceProcessDefinition, ProcessDefinitionImpl targetProcessDefinition, ValidatingMigrationInstructions existingInstructions, boolean updateEventTriggers) MigrationInstructionGenerator.generate
(ProcessDefinitionImpl sourceProcessDefinition, ProcessDefinitionImpl targetProcessDefinition, boolean updateEventTriggers) Generate all migration instructions for mapped activities between two process definitions. -
Uses of ProcessDefinitionImpl in org.camunda.bpm.engine.impl.migration.instance.parser
Modifier and TypeMethodDescriptionMigratingInstanceParseContext.getSourceProcessDefinition()
MigratingInstanceParseContext.getTargetProcessDefinition()
-
Uses of ProcessDefinitionImpl in org.camunda.bpm.engine.impl.persistence.entity
Modifier and TypeClassDescriptionclass
class
Modifier and TypeMethodDescriptionvoid
ExecutionEntity.setProcessDefinition
(ProcessDefinitionImpl processDefinition) -
Uses of ProcessDefinitionImpl in org.camunda.bpm.engine.impl.pvm
Modifier and TypeFieldDescriptionprotected ProcessDefinitionImpl
ProcessDefinitionBuilder.processDefinition
-
Uses of ProcessDefinitionImpl in org.camunda.bpm.engine.impl.pvm.process
Modifier and TypeFieldDescriptionprotected ProcessDefinitionImpl
ScopeImpl.processDefinition
protected ProcessDefinitionImpl
TransitionImpl.processDefinition
ModifierConstructorDescriptionActivityImpl
(String id, ProcessDefinitionImpl processDefinition) ScopeImpl
(String id, ProcessDefinitionImpl processDefinition) TransitionImpl
(String id, ProcessDefinitionImpl processDefinition) -
Uses of ProcessDefinitionImpl in org.camunda.bpm.engine.impl.pvm.runtime
Modifier and TypeFieldDescriptionprotected ProcessDefinitionImpl
PvmExecutionImpl.processDefinition
Modifier and TypeMethodDescriptionvoid
PvmExecutionImpl.setProcessDefinition
(ProcessDefinitionImpl processDefinition) -
Uses of ProcessDefinitionImpl in org.camunda.bpm.engine.impl.util
Modifier and TypeMethodDescriptionstatic ProcessDefinitionImpl
CallableElementUtil.getProcessDefinitionToCall
(VariableScope execution, String defaultTenantId, BaseCallableElement callableElement)